In This Blog:
- OpenAI has initiated a test phase for a new memory feature in ChatGPT, aimed at a select group of users.
- This feature allows ChatGPT to remember details from previous interactions, enhancing personalization and usefulness in conversations.
- Users have full control over the memory feature, including options to delete specific memories, clear all memory, or disable the feature entirely.
- The memory capability enables ChatGPT to understand user preferences, context, and instructions better, making interactions more relevant over time.
- The experiment is currently available to a limited number of both free and premium users, with plans for a wider release in the future.

How Does It Work? With this new memory capability, ChatGPT can now hold onto important bits from your past chats — your preferences, the context of your questions, specific instructions you gave, and more. This isn’t just about remembering facts; it’s about understanding you better over time. And for those building with GPTs, there’s even more good news. They’ll have the ability to tap into these memory features to create even more personalized experiences.
Who Gets to Try It First? If you’re eager to see this feature in action, you might not have to wait too long. The experiment is rolling out to a small percentage of users, both free and premium, starting this week. And if you’re not among the lucky few, don’t worry. A broader rollout is expected down the line.
